Comparative Analysis of LCX and Bidirectional Antenna Performance in Jakarta MRT Telecommunication System

Abstract

Telecommunication system reliability is critical to the operation of the Jakarta MRT, particularly for Train-to-Ground communication, CCTV transmission, and passenger information services. This study compares the performance of Leaky Coaxial Cable (LCX) and bidirectional antennas using MATLAB-based numerical simulation founded on a modified empirical propagation model, evaluated at frequencies of 5.2 GHz and 5.8 GHz over distances of 10–2000 m, with path loss, SNR, BER, and effective throughput as the analyzed parameters. At a distance of 2000 m and a frequency of 5.2 GHz, LCX yielded a path loss of 149.2255 dB, an SNR of -14.2586 dB, a BER of 0.3921, and a throughput of 6.0792 Mbps, outperforming the bidirectional antenna, which yielded a path loss of 156.8298 dB, an SNR of -21.8629 dB, a BER of 0.4546, and a throughput of 5.4543 Mbps.
